Description

Bicknor Bridge, located in North Molton, is a bridge that likely dates back to the early 17th century, with some alterations made in the late 20th century. It is constructed from coursed stone rubble, featuring dressed stone voussoirs and cutwaters, as well as some dressed stone on the abutments. The bridge has a shallow humped-back design and consists of two round arches, with triangular cutwaters on each pier. The abutments are curved, and the original parapet has been replaced by railings from the late 20th century. This bridge carries the lane between North Molton and Bicknor Farm, which is located in the neighboring parish, across the River Mole, marking the boundary between the two parishes.
